Acumatica

Acumatica is a versatile cloud ERP designed to connect every part of your business through a single, integrated platform. Instead of juggling disconnected spreadsheets, you can manage your finances, customer relationships, and inventory in one place. The system adapts to your specific industry needs, whether you operate in manufacturing, distribution, retail, or construction, ensuring your data flows smoothly across departments.

You can access your business data from any device at any time, which keeps your remote and office teams perfectly synced. Because the platform uses a unique consumption-based pricing model rather than charging per user, you can involve your entire workforce in your digital processes without worrying about rising license costs as your team grows.

Ollie

Ollie provides a specialized platform built specifically for the craft beverage industry to help you manage your entire production cycle. You can transition away from messy spreadsheets and fragmented tools by centralizing your raw material tracking, recipe management, and fermentation logs in one digital workspace. The software ensures you never run out of critical ingredients while maintaining consistent quality across every batch you brew.

Beyond the brewhouse, you can manage your entire commercial operation by processing wholesale orders and tracking payments in real-time. It simplifies complex tasks like TTB reporting and inventory auditing, giving you back hours of administrative time each week. Whether you are running a small local taproom or a regional distribution powerhouse, you can scale your production and sales with data-driven insights.

Acumatica Features

  • Financial Management Manage your general ledger, accounts payable, and accounts receivable with automated workflows that simplify your complex global accounting needs.
  • Inventory Management Track your stock levels across multiple locations in real-time to reduce carrying costs and prevent stockouts or overstocking.
  • Project Accounting Monitor your project costs, revenues, and budgets accurately to ensure every job stays profitable and finishes on schedule.
  • CRM Integration Consolidate your customer data so your sales and support teams have a 360-degree view of every client interaction.
  • Automated Workflows Create custom business rules that trigger notifications and approvals automatically to eliminate manual bottlenecks in your daily operations.
  • Mobile App Access Enter timecards, expense claims, and service orders from your smartphone while in the field to keep office records current.

Ollie Features

  • Production Planning. Schedule your brews and track fermentation progress with visual logs that keep your entire production team synchronized.
  • Inventory Management. Track raw materials and finished goods in real-time so you always know exactly what is in your cold room.
  • Wholesale Ordering. Process customer orders through a dedicated portal that automatically updates your inventory levels and generates professional invoices.
  • Automated TTB Reporting. Generate accurate federal and state tax reports with a single click to ensure your brewery stays compliant.
  • Recipe Management. Store and scale your recipes digitally to ensure consistent flavor profiles and precise hop utilization across every batch.
  • Payments & Accounting. Collect payments faster by integrating your sales data directly with popular accounting tools like QuickBooks and Xero.

Acumatica

Pros

  • Unlimited user licensing encourages company-wide adoption
  • Highly flexible platform allows for deep customization
  • Strong industry-specific editions for construction and manufacturing
  • Modern browser-based interface works on any device

Cons

  • Implementation requires significant time and technical expertise
  • Customization can lead to complexity during version upgrades
  • Pricing can be difficult to predict as transactions scale
A

Ollie

Pros

  • Intuitive interface designed specifically for brewery workflows
  • Excellent customer support with deep industry knowledge
  • Simplifies complex TTB and state tax reporting
  • Centralizes sales and production in one place

Cons

  • Initial data migration requires significant time investment
  • Mobile experience could be more feature-rich
  • Custom pricing may be high for nanobreweries
